Kubota L1-28
The Kubota L1-28 is a utility tractor made from 1983 to 1985. It's a 2WD tractor with a shuttle transmission that has 16 forward and 16 reverse gears. This tractor is powered by a Kubota V1512 engine, which is a 4-cylinder, liquid-cooled diesel engine. The engine is naturally aspirated and has a displacement of 91.5 ci, which is below average for tractors. It runs at 2700 rpm, which is very high, and produces 27.6 hp, which is below average power for tractors. The L1-28 is compact, measuring 124.4 inches long, 55.9 inches wide, and 77.8 inches tall. It weighs 2546 lb, which is lighter than most tractors. This tractor has agricultural tires on both front and rear wheels. It features a Type I rear hitch and an electric starter. The L1-28 is part of Kubota's L1 Series and has a wheelbase of 68.3 inches. It uses a dry disc clutch and operates on a 12-volt electrical system.

Head to head
L1-28 vs. Utility median
How the Kubota L1-28 compares to other Utility tractors
| Spec | This model | Utility median | Difference | Percentile |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Engine Power | 27.6 hp | 55 hp | -50% | 19th |
| Engine Displacement | 91.5 ci | 183 ci | -50% | 20th |
| Cylinders | 4 | 4 | at median | 50th |
| Forward Gears | 16 | 12 | +33% | 73rd |
| Operating Weight | 2,546 lb | 5,303 lb | -52% | 17th |
| Length | 124 in | 137 in | -9% | 34th |
| Width | 55.9 in | 66 in | -15% | 29th |
| Height | 77.8 in | 94.1 in | -17% | 24th |
Medians and percentiles are computed from the utility tractors in our database with a recorded value for each spec (sample sizes 3,933–5,720 models).
